Apologies if we've already talked about this (I feel like we have, but I couldn't find it), but for those of you who work out in the mornings, do you eat before? What do you eat? I vaguely recall something in the nutrition guide advising to do it on an empty stomach, and that is what I do. But I've had a couple of days here and there that I've been crazy dizzy during or after the workout and I assume that has something to do with it.
I'm a super super picky eater so I won't do supplements or shakes of any kind, but wondering whether I should be eating before I workout, what are good things to have, and how long do I have to wait after eating before I work out?
I'd love to hear what you guys think.

When I was eating at a large deficit I would totally bonk during workouts. I started eating just a bit of oatmeal or peanut butter before workouts when that was happening/0

I don't workout first thing in the morning, but when I run half marathons I will eat a banana and a bagel, or some oatmeal about 90 minutes prior to the race.

I take shakes and suppliments lol. Seriously when I need a kick of energy I take a carb supp that is pure carbs...goes right to the muscles and i burn it all off during the workout so it's like free carbs. Same concept as Gels that distance runners and cyclists use(I use them for cycling too).
If you're doing food you would want food high on the glycemic index to give that burst of energy right away.0 -
I do not work out at the morning, but I do low(er) carb and to fuel my workout I have been advised to eat at least 30 g carb prior to workout, and at least 20 g after. Also fat slows digestion, so avoid in the preworkout. Meal because you want those carb to be available right away.
I would drink a banana milkshake or something like that which is lots of carb and get digested right away.0
